Different Welder’s Certifications

Despite the fact that the AWS’ standard CW (Certified Welder) credential paves the way for almost all jobs, specific industries will require a specialized certification. Several of the most-common of them appear below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for those that work with boiler and pressurized containers
  • CW Certification to be a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for individuals who work on pipelines in the gas and oil field
  • SCWI and CWI Certificates for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ors

The Ins and Outs of Welder Courses

Although there isn’t a book teaching how to pick the best welding schools, there are some things to consider. The first task in getting started with a position as a welder is to decide which of the top brazing courses will help you. welding specialist program or school you ultimately choose will have to be recognized by the American Welding Society. If accreditation is good, you may want to take a look at a few other features of the program in comparison with other training programs providing the same instruction.

  • You should make sure the school’s curriculum provides you with courses in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
  • Attempt to find institutions that meet AWS SENSE standards
  • Learn if the college provides financial support
  • Make certain the school teaches with tools that matches up-to-date trade requirements
